About


Daniel Hurlbert is a software start-up veteran with over 20 years of experience architecting applications, creating teams, and developing software applications. After purchasing his 2005 Ferrari F430 in 2016, he started his YouTube channel “Normal Guy Supercar” to document his experience of what it was like to be a “normal guy” that happened to own a “supercar.”  This included doing maintenance at home, showing the actual costs, new experiences, and of course meeting new friends.  “Normal Guy Supercar” has become synonymous with videos about the Ferrari F430 and has inspired many people to purchase Ferraris once they demystify what ownership is actually like.

 

Summary

YouTube creator and former CTO with proven success in multiple start-ups, extensive software development experience, agile, broad knowledge base, excellent written and verbal communication skills, independent as well as team experience, large and small engineering organizations, and a strong understanding and application of software design and architecture.

Things that I might know:

 

  • Agile
  • AJAX
  • Analytics
  • AngularJS
  • Apache
  • AWS
  • Bootstrap
  • Business Intelligence
  • C#
  • C/C++
  • Confluence
  • CSS
  • DNS
  • DoD Security Clearance
  • EC2
  • Enterprise Architect
  • GIT
  • HTML
  • Java
  • Javascript
  • JIRA
  • jQuery
  • JSON
  • LabVIEW
  • Leadership
  • Linux / UNIX
  • MS SQL
  • MySQL
  • NIST
  • NodeJS
  • PCI DSS
  • PHP
  • Product Architecture
  • Product Management
  • Project Management
  • Qlikview
  • RDS
  • Recruiting
  • REST
  • SaaS
  • Scalability
  • Scrum
  • SOAP
  • Software Design
  • Start-ups
  • Stash/BitBucket
  • Statistics
  • SVN
  • Technology Executive
  • Webservices
  • XML

Experience

CTO at the Permanent Legacy Foundation

December 2014 – December 2018

The Permanent Legacy Foundation is a 501(c)3 non-profit organization creating the world’s first and only permanent data preservation system.  Through an endowment model, the non-profit will have the ability to endure time and ensure data is kept safe and available permanently without need for advertising or other marketing channels to generate revenue.  The application utilizes various engines to translate datatypes, check on bit decay, and store data redundantly across multiple systems in multiple locations.  It also has a presentation layer to allow preserved data to be accessible on all devices at any time.

My role goes beyond the typical CTO at The Permanent Legacy Foundation.  For the first 3 years I was the only executive at the organization so I was essentially filling in as the interim CEO as well as CTO.  My duties range from architecting the application, hiring all employees, writing code, and even creating the marketing strategy.

  • Pre-revenue Nonprofit Startup about to publicly launch after 4+ years of development
  • Responsible for all technology (design, architect, QA, infrastructure)
  • Responsible for all employees
  • Recruit all staff
  • Lead technology, QA, and marketing teams
  • Plan and schedule work
  • Create and manage DEV-OPS, deployment tools, automated testing, project management tools (JIRA, Confluence, BitBucket, etc)
  • Prioritize work to achieve goals rapidly and launch early next year

Consultant at Modernize

December 2014 – December 2015

Upon my resignation from Modernize, I offered to help transition the company to a new VP of Engineering.  I assisted the company in many ways, from training staff all the way to writing code.  I was frequently given projects to help increase revenue or fine tune existing systems/algorithm.

  • Assisting with core technology stack
  • One off projects
  • Provide skills training
  • Support transition to new engineering management

 Vice President of Software Engineering at Modernize

November 2011 – December 2014

Modernize (previously Home Improvement Leads, Calfinder) is a privately held referral service company for the residential home improvement industry.  Through technology advancements, business intelligence, and strategic geographic and demographic focus, Modernize has grown to the second largest provider of residential home improvement leads in the US marketplace.

I was hired to replace all 3rd party software solutions with in-house solutions from scratch.  In only 3 years, my team was able to implement fully autonomous lead routing systems, ad generation systems, business intelligence, reporting, and other tools that enabled the company to grow rapidly and dramatically increase revenue and profitability.  I had to frequently work with marketing and sales teams to create solutions that enabled grow or provided insights allowing these teams to achieve their goals – ultimately helping the company achieve broader revenue and growth goals.

  • Enabled company to scale from $7M to $35MM+ annual revenue in 3 years
  • Increased the valuation of the company from $6M to $75M in 4 years.
  • Increased net profit to over 30%
  • Responsible for the Software Engineering, Software Quality Assurance, and Business Intelligence teams
  • Self-funded startup with only 1 external investor
  • Design applications
  • Plan, schedule, and monitor all development tasks
  • Run Agile Development planning meetings
  • Recruit and hire all employees in the Engineering Department
  • Mentor and train employees
  • Work with other executives to increase revenue/profitability of company
  • Designed and created development processes
  • Designed and created systems architecture
  • Created Business Intelligence reporting systems
  • Architect for all technology solutions
  • Plan and budget the Engineering Department

Team Lead, Data Security Architect at Mattersight Corporation

April 2006 – October 2011

Mattersight (previously eLoyalty, recently acquired) is a public SaaS company providing solutions for large call centers.  Their products and services increase the efficacy of agents by providing analytics, call routing, insights, and personality modeling.

My role at Mattersight evolved rapidly.  Initially hired to be one of the lead developers, I was quickly given a team of engineers.  My team was tasked with ensuring the security of the application.  Our goals were to create solutions to meet all security and compliance standards.

  • Team lead on the Behavioral Analytics portal development team
  • Head of the Security Focus Group
  • Responsible for ensuring code meets and exceeds PCI DSS and NIST compliance
  • Project manager of multiple applications/projects
  • Assigns other programmers work and monitors their progress
  • Estimates work effort and schedule tasks to iterations
  • Involved in design and architecture
  • Trains all new developers
  • Trained in Agile Software Development, attended Agile Software Development classes
  • Develop, enforce and maintain coding standards
  • Performs code reviews
  • Performs security audits on all tasks related to the portal project
  • Enterprise level PHP application development
  • Model View Controller (MVC) AJAX application
  • Subject Matter Expert and designer of the application security modules
  • Large database design and use experience
  • Responsible for interviewing potential new employees for the team

Web Applications Programmer at PureData

April 2004 – April 2006

  • Web applications design and programming in PHP, ASP/ASP.NET, Java Script, AJAX, and HTML with MySQL and MS SQL databases
  • Highly involved in the specifications, design, creation, implementation, support, and warranty of most software projects
  • Produced code with an emphasis on quality and security
  • Software projects including E-commerce, photo gallery/sharing, research and development, accounting, and reporting systems
  • Created websites with Content Management Systems and translation engines
  • Assisted with project management
  • Direct interaction with clients during all phases of development
  • System Administrator of all servers (Linux and Windows) and workstations
  • Creation and maintenance of Apache, Qmail, IIS, MySQL, and MS SQL servers
  • Wrote custom scripts to monitor servers and produce daily reporting statistics 

Data Acquisition Consultant at Western Michigan University

April 1999 – March 2004

  • Provided consultation for the design and implementation of the Tribology Lab’s data acquisition systems at Western Michigan University
  • Created software to fully automate tests from start to finish 

Data Acquisition Programmer & Lab Technician at Flowserve

April 1999 – December 2003

  • Data acquisitions programmer – designed, programmed, produced, and maintained all of the data acquisitions systems software and hardware
  • Strong emphasis on LabVIEW programming and National Instruments Field Point hardware
  • Integral part of the Research and Development team, altering software and hardware to match specified requirements for customized test environments
  • Created software safety systems to prevent the failure of equipment, saving millions of dollars in lost hardware and test equipment
  • Implemented notification system that alerts operators of any anomalies
  • Software used a “One Click” start to finish for fully automated test parameters

Education

Western Michigan University, Kalamazoo, Michigan, 2001 – 2004
Bachelors of Science in Computer Science with a Mathematics minor

University of Michigan, College of Engineering, Ann Arbor, Michigan, 1998 – 2000 Studied Mechanical Engineering